For e21a, you don’t need quad host, because there is still no “regular” quad PCBs for these LEDs available. But you can use them with special 4x array PCB (or even XM PCB) close to each other, with big base tir or reflector, in many single led hosts.

Since you’re talking about Wizard Pro Rofis R1, R2, R3 or R4 are also good hosts for e21A. Can be anywhere between straight and 90 degrees. I have R1 with quadtrix and R2 with single e21A. There’s donut hole with stock reflector even with single emitter but easily fixed with DC fix or optics (I sanded down 17mm Yajiamei).

You’re gonna smoke those poor little E21 LEDs with a FET DD driver.
Very low Vf and relatively poor thermal properties.
Before you know it you’re well over 2 Amperes for each LED and then the heat will will fry them.

I have an R1 I’d like to mod with one of these. What do I need to order?

You can buy e21A or e17A emitters and mcpcb for quadtrix from Clemence here. You can have him reflow the leds too since they’re quite difficult to reflow properly. Bezel of r1 is press-fitted but not that difficult to remove. Here is an example of how to remove it without damaging it so much. It uses 16mm mcpcb. With stock reflector, beam will be ugly and have a very distinct donut hole. DC fix which you can buy from Boaz here in BLF cleans the beam nicely. If you want to use optics I used 17mm Yajiamei but had to trim it down the base with sandpaper to make it fit. You would also need something to press the bezel back into place at reassembly. Be careful when pressing down bezel and make sure the optics is aligned properly so as not to crush the leds (e21A and e17a are quite fragile). If the optics is too tall you might also break the glass lens while pressing so make sure it’s the right height.
